In 2002, Vikas was involved in designing and building one of the world's most comprehensive clinical mental health systems for ACT Mental Health Services in Canberra, Australia.
He has developed applications for research organisations like kConFab, Peter MacCallum and the Australasian Biospecimen Network Association. He has also designed and managed the development of a visual inventory management solution to manage stem cells for the Australian Stem cell centre.
In 2006 when headspace, Australia's national youth mental health initiative, was founded, Vikas designed the technology and managed the rollout to the first 40 centres. The solution included a national minimum dataset, a clinical system and a dimensional data warehouse for operation analysis and understanding correlations between diagnosis, risk of suicide, substance abuse and early interventions.
Vikas was the Principal Consultant for auditing the National Blood Bank Service's technology (Ministry of Health, Malaysia) and recommending changes. He has also worked with Dr Nor Hayati Ali in providing solution consulting in mental health for Malaysia's national transition from an inpatient-based care model to community-based care (Mantari).
In 2017, everMind re-platformed its mental health ePST(Problem Solving Treatment) solution. This solution was initially built as a desktop application for NASA astronauts to treat anxiety and depression in space. Vikas engaged and supervised a team to rebuild the application using a scalable, multi-tiered, multi-tenanted, mobile-first design.
In 2021, Vikas provided youth engagement support through Mentegram for Sonder's youth mental health services and the Momentum QP Youth Mental Health AOD (Alcohol and Other Drug) and Homelessness Service at Richmond Wellbeing.
In early 2022, he implemented Mentegram at Bethesda Clinic, a 75 bed inpatient and outpatient service in Perth, WA.
In 2022, he helped architect and design usupport, a digital mental health platform and framework for UNICEF.
In 2023, he collaborated with UNICEF Office of Innovation in Stockholm, Sweden, evaluating solutions from international partners for potential implementation on the UNICEF uSupport platform.
In 2024, he continuous supporting the UNICEF uSupport implementations across multiple European and Central Asian countries
